Machining the Part
The material to be machined is placed on the Shark SD110/SD120 work table and properly
secured
–
typically by using clamps. The proper cutter tool is placed in the router. Using the
Shark SD110/SD120 LCD Pendant Touch Screen, the tool is moved (jogged) to correspond with
the starting point of what you have designed, usually a corner or center of the work piece. Once
you have it in position you press the Zero xyz button, answer yes to reset zero and this becomes
the starting and stopping place for this project. (You can place your material anywhere on the
table and reset home in this manner)
Main Screen of Shark SD110/SD120
You can also move any axis by typing a measurement directly into the current location screen.
Pressing the location area will display the screen below.
